Output 6ac5520ca6d2bc9ca4f81f0ec16bd76d67a80e9d239458ca202657109d10bbaa:2

value
25448904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d35cfdf9771e53dffb28dda94431c027f7b454c OP_EQUAL
address
MEwQj8C9PzjPxRmUYcdVTHyxDefSsqU2xH
transaction
6ac5520ca6d2bc9ca4f81f0ec16bd76d67a80e9d239458ca202657109d10bbaa
spent
true